How to Reach Midfield in the United States

Midfield is a small town located in the state of Alabama, United States. Nestled in Jefferson County, it offers a charming and serene environment for both residents and visitors. Here's how you can reach Midfield:

By Air

The nearest major airport to Midfield is the Birmingham-Shuttlesworth International Airport (BHM), located approximately 8 miles northeast of the town. From the airport, you can easily rent a car or take a taxi to reach Midfield. Several airlines operate regular flights to and from this airport, ensuring convenient access for travelers.

By Road

If you prefer driving, Midfield can be reached via Interstate 20/59, which runs through the town. This interstate connects Midfield to major cities like Birmingham (to the northeast) and Tuscaloosa (to the southwest). Depending on your starting location, you can plan your route accordingly and enjoy a scenic road trip to Midfield.

By Public Transportation

For those who prefer public transportation, the Birmingham-Jefferson County Transit Authority (BJCTA) offers bus services that connect Midfield to various parts of the region. You can check the BJCTA website for schedules and routes to plan your journey accordingly. This option is not only convenient but also an eco-friendly way to reach Midfield.

By Train

While Midfield does not have its own train station, the nearby city of Birmingham is well-connected by Amtrak, the national rail service in the United States. You can take an Amtrak train to Birmingham and then use other modes of transportation, such as buses or taxis, to reach Midfield.

Getting to know Midfield

Midfield is a small town located in the United States. Situated in the state of Alabama, it is part of Jefferson County. With a population of approximately 5,365 people, Midfield is a close-knit community that offers a peaceful and quiet lifestyle.

The town of Midfield covers a total area of 2.5 square miles, providing residents with ample space to live, work, and play. It is conveniently located near several major cities, including Birmingham, which is just a short drive away. This allows residents to easily access a wide range of amenities and recreational opportunities.

Midfield has a rich history that dates back to its establishment in the early 20th century. Originally known as Corey, the town was renamed Midfield in 1953 to reflect its central location within Jefferson County. Over the years, Midfield has grown and developed into a thriving community with a strong sense of pride and identity.

One of the notable features of Midfield is its commitment to education. The town is served by the Midfield City Schools District, which provides quality education to students from preschool through high school. The district is known for its dedicated teachers, modern facilities, and innovative programs that prepare students for success in the future.
